The Whispering Crypt of the Forbidden Chamber

In the heart of the ancient city of Erebos, beneath the cobbled streets that echoed with the footsteps of the living, lay a crypt known only to a few: the Whispering Crypt of the Forbidden Chamber. It was said that the crypt was the resting place of the ancient sages who had once ruled the land, their knowledge encoded in the walls and whispered by the very stones themselves.

The city of Erebos had long been a place of mystery and intrigue, its origins shrouded in the mists of time. The citizens, a blend of races and cultures, lived under the watchful eye of the High Council, a group of elders who claimed to be the keepers of the ancient prophecies. One such elder, a scribe named Elara, had dedicated her life to deciphering the cryptic texts that adorned the walls of the Forbidden Chamber.

Elara was no ordinary scribe. Her eyes held the wisdom of ages, and her fingers, the delicate touch of a master craftsman. She had spent her days translating the cryptic symbols, her nights dreaming of the secrets they held. But it was a particular symbol, a coiled serpent biting its own tail, that had called to her like a siren's song.

The symbol, known as the Serpent's Embrace, was said to be the key to the most ancient and powerful of prophecies. According to the lore, it foretold the rise of a great darkness that would consume the world unless the chosen one could decipher its meaning and prevent the disaster from unfolding.

One fateful evening, as the sun dipped below the horizon, casting the city in twilight shadows, Elara found herself standing before the entrance to the Forbidden Chamber. The air was thick with anticipation, and the crypt itself seemed to hum with ancient power. She took a deep breath and stepped inside, the heavy door closing behind her with a resounding thud.

The chamber was vast, its walls lined with carvings and inscriptions that seemed to glow with an inner light. Elara's eyes scanned the room, her heart pounding with a mix of fear and excitement. She moved cautiously, her fingers tracing the carvings, until she found the Serpent's Embrace.

As she traced the symbol, a voice echoed through the chamber, a voice that was both familiar and alien. "Seek not the truth, but the balance. The path you seek is fraught with peril, Elara. Are you ready to embrace the darkness that lies within you?"

Elara gasped, her heart racing. She knew the voice was that of the ancient sages, their warnings and prophecies echoing through the ages. She had to find the balance, but how?

Her journey took her to the farthest reaches of the land, from the towering mountains to the deepest forests, and even to the edge of the world where the sun set and rose in a perpetual twilight. Along the way, she encountered allies and enemies alike, each with their own motives and agendas.

One such ally was a young warrior named Kael, whose eyes held the fire of a thousand suns. He had been searching for the same truth as Elara, and together, they faced the perils that lay ahead.

The journey was long and arduous, filled with challenges that tested their resolve and their very souls. They encountered creatures of myth and legend, each more terrifying than the last, and they faced the High Council, who sought to use the prophecy for their own gain.

As the days turned into weeks, Elara and Kael grew closer, their bond forged in the fires of adversity. But the true test was yet to come.

The climax of their journey came in the heart of the Whispering Crypt, where the ancient sages had once gathered. There, Elara faced the ultimate challenge: to embrace the darkness within her and become the chosen one, or to reject the darkness and face the consequences of the prophecy.

In a moment of truth, Elara chose the path of balance. She accepted the darkness, not as a force to be feared, but as a part of her own essence. With the ancient sages' guidance, she unraveled the true meaning of the Serpent's Embrace and discovered that the prophecy was not a foretold doom, but a warning of the balance that must be maintained.

The ending of her quest was not one of victory or defeat, but of understanding and acceptance. Elara and Kael returned to Erebos, their mission complete, the prophecy fulfilled. The High Council, now enlightened by Elara's wisdom, vowed to protect the balance of the world.

And so, the Whispering Crypt of the Forbidden Chamber remained a place of mystery and wonder, its secrets whispered only to those who sought the truth and the balance that lay within.
